Nova turma com conversação 5x por semana 🔥

Nova turma com conversação 5x por semana 🔥

O que é o front-end e por que aprender a programar nessa área?

O desenvolvimento front-end refere-se à parte visual e interativa de um site ou aplicativo. É a área responsável por criar a interface com o usuário, tornando a experiência de navegação agradável e intuitiva. Aprender a programar nessa área é essencial para quem deseja se tornar um desenvolvedor web completo e ter habilidades procuradas no mercado de trabalho.

A importância do front-end

A importância do front-end está relacionada ao fato de que é a primeira impressão que os usuários têm de um site ou aplicativo. Uma interface bem projetada, com boa usabilidade e design atraente, pode influenciar diretamente a satisfação e a permanência do usuário na plataforma. Além disso, o desenvolvimento front-end também envolve a otimização do site para diferentes dispositivos, como computadores, tablets e smartphones, garantindo uma experiência consistente em todas as plataformas.

Linguagens e ferramentas

Ao aprender a programar front-end, você estará adquirindo habilidades em linguagens como HTML, CSS e JavaScript. O HTML (HyperText Markup Language) é a base de qualquer página web, sendo responsável pela estrutura e organização do conteúdo. O CSS (Cascading Style Sheets) é utilizado para estilizar a página, definindo o layout, cores, fontes e outros aspectos visuais. Já o JavaScript é uma linguagem de programação que permite adicionar interatividade e dinamismo aos elementos da página.

Além dessas linguagens, é importante também estar familiarizado com frameworks e bibliotecas populares, como Bootstrap, React e Angular. Essas ferramentas facilitam o desenvolvimento, oferecendo componentes prontos e uma estrutura sólida para a criação de interfaces responsivas e de alto desempenho.

Como iniciar no desenvolvimento front-end: recursos e ferramentas essenciais

Se você está começando sua jornada no desenvolvimento front-end, é importante ter acesso aos recursos e ferramentas essenciais para facilitar seu aprendizado e prática. Aqui estão algumas recomendações:

  1. Utilize um editor de código eficiente e personalizável, como o Visual Studio Code, Sublime Text ou Atom. Essas ferramentas oferecem recursos avançados, como realce de sintaxe, auto completar, integração com controle de versão e muito mais.
  2. Utilize a documentação oficial das linguagens e frameworks que você está aprendendo. Elas fornecem informações detalhadas sobre uso, sintaxe e exemplos práticos.
  3. Existem diversos tutoriais e cursos online gratuitos ou pagos que ensinam desde o básico até o avançado do desenvolvimento front-end. Utilize esses recursos para aprimorar seus conhecimentos e aprender novas técnicas.
  4. Participe de comunidades online, como fóruns e grupos de discussão, onde você pode fazer perguntas, compartilhar conhecimentos e obter suporte de outros desenvolvedores.
  5. A prática é fundamental para se tornar um programador front-end habilidoso. Crie projetos pessoais, resolva desafios e participe de competições de programação para aprimorar suas habilidades.

Aprenda a programar front-end passo a passo: do básico ao avançado

Aprender a programar front-end pode parecer desafiador no início, mas com dedicação e prática você pode dominar essa área. Aqui está um guia passo a passo para você começar:

  1. Comece aprendendo a estrutura básica do HTML e como criar elementos como cabeçalhos, parágrafos, imagens e links. Domine os conceitos de tags, atributos e organização do conteúdo.
  2. Em seguida, aprenda a estilizar sua página com CSS. Explore diferentes propriedades, como cores, fontes, tamanhos e posicionamentos. Aprenda a usar seletores e classes para aplicar estilos específicos a elementos específicos.
  3. Agora é hora de adicionar interatividade à sua página com JavaScript. Aprenda os conceitos básicos da linguagem, como variáveis, condicionais, loops e funções. Explore também o uso de eventos para tornar sua página mais dinâmica.
  4. Ao dominar as bases do front-end, experimente frameworks e bibliotecas populares, como Bootstrap, React ou Angular. Eles fornecem componentes reutilizáveis e facilitam a criação de interfaces responsivas e interativas.
  5. Continue aprendendo e aprimorando suas habilidades. Explore conceitos avançados de CSS, como flexbox e grid layout, e aprenda técnicas avançadas de JavaScript, como manipulação do DOM e AJAX.

Dicas e recomendações para se tornar um programador front-end de sucesso

Para se tornar um programador front-end de sucesso, aqui estão algumas dicas e recomendações importantes:

  1. Mantenha-se atualizado sobre as tendências e novas tecnologias do front-end.
  2. Crie um portfólio de projetos pessoais para mostrar suas habilidades e experiência.
  3. Participe de comunidades online de desenvolvedores front-end para compartilhar conhecimentos e se manter atualizado.
  4. Pratique resolvendo problemas de programação para aprimorar suas habilidades.
  5. Aprenda com projetos reais, contribuindo para projetos de código aberto ou participando de equipes de desenvolvimento.

Aprender a programar front-end é uma escolha inteligente para quem deseja se destacar no mercado de desenvolvimento web. Com as habilidades certas, você pode criar interfaces incríveis, otimizadas e interativas. Siga o guia completo para iniciantes e esteja preparado para embarcar em uma jornada de aprendizado e crescimento constantes. Aprenda a programar front-end e torne-se um desenvolvedor de sucesso!

A Awari é a melhor plataforma para aprender sobre programação no Brasil.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ais.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

Próximos conteúdos

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
inscreva-se

Entre para a próxima turma com bônus exclusivos

Faça parte da maior escola de idiomas do mundo com os professores mais amados da internet.

Curso completo do básico ao avançado
Aplicativo de memorização para lembrar de tudo que aprendeu
Aulas de conversação para destravar um novo idioma
Certificado reconhecido no mercado
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
Empresa
Ex.: Fluency Academy
Ao clicar no botão “Solicitar Proposta”, você concorda com os nossos Termos de Uso e Política de Privacidade.